Global Metal Nitrides Market is Projected to Reach USD 5.92 Billion by 2030

 According to the report published by Virtue Market Research in The Global Metal Nitrides Market was valued at USD 3.84 billion in 2025 and is projected to reach a market size of USD 5.92 billion by the end of 2030, expanding at a CAGR of 9.1% during the forecast period from 2025 to 2030.

The market is witnessing steady growth driven by increasing demand for high-performance materials across electronics, automotive, aerospace, and energy industries. Metal nitrides are widely valued for their exceptional hardness, thermal stability, corrosion resistance, electrical insulation properties, and wear resistance, making them critical in advanced industrial and technological applications.

A key long-term growth driver is the rapid expansion of the semiconductor and electronics sector. Metal nitrides such as silicon nitride and aluminum nitride are extensively used in microelectronics, integrated circuits, power electronics, and semiconductor packaging due to their superior dielectric strength, thermal conductivity, and reliability under extreme operating conditions.

The COVID-19 pandemic had a mixed impact on the metal nitrides market. While short-term disruptions affected manufacturing and supply chains, demand rebounded strongly due to accelerated investments in electronics, renewable energy, and advanced manufacturing. Post-pandemic recovery has reinforced the need for durable, high-efficiency materials in critical infrastructure and industrial systems.

In the short to medium term, rising adoption of electric vehicles, renewable energy systems, and advanced coating technologies is supporting market expansion. Metal nitrides are increasingly used in cutting tools, protective coatings, turbine components, and energy storage systems, improving performance, lifespan, and operational efficiency.

A major opportunity lies in research and development of next-generation nitride materials for wide-bandgap semiconductors, thermal management solutions, and aerospace-grade coatings. One of the most notable trends in the market is the growing integration of metal nitrides in power electronics and high-temperature applications, positioning them as essential materials for future industrial innovation.

Market Segmentation

By Type: Titanium Nitride (TiN), Aluminum Nitride (AlN), Silicon Nitride (Si₃N₄), Boron Nitride (BN)

Titanium nitride holds a significant share of the market due to its widespread use in hard coatings for cutting tools, medical devices, and decorative applications. Its excellent wear resistance and golden appearance make it a preferred choice in both industrial and consumer applications.

Aluminum nitride is gaining strong traction due to its high thermal conductivity and electrical insulation properties, making it ideal for power electronics, LED substrates, and semiconductor packaging. Silicon nitride is extensively used in automotive and aerospace applications, particularly in bearings, engine components, and turbine parts, due to its high strength and thermal shock resistance. Boron nitride is witnessing increasing demand in high-temperature lubrication, electrical insulation, and chemical processing applications, supported by its unique combination of thermal stability and chemical inertness.

By End-User: Electronics and Semiconductor, Automotive, Aerospace and Defense, Energy and Power Generation, Chemicals and Pharmaceuticals, Others

The electronics and semiconductor segment dominates the market, driven by rising production of integrated circuits, power devices, and advanced electronic components. Metal nitrides play a critical role in improving thermal management, reliability, and miniaturization of electronic systems.

The automotive sector represents a growing end-user segment, supported by increasing use of metal nitrides in engine components, wear-resistant coatings, and electric vehicle power systems. Aerospace and defense applications benefit from the high strength-to-weight ratio, thermal resistance, and durability of metal nitrides in extreme environments.

Energy and power generation applications are expanding due to increased deployment of renewable energy systems and high-efficiency power electronics. The chemicals and pharmaceuticals segment utilizes metal nitrides for corrosion-resistant equipment, catalytic processes, and high-purity manufacturing environments.

Regional Analysis

Asia-Pacific leads the global metal nitrides market, driven by strong semiconductor manufacturing activity, rapid industrialization, and expanding automotive production in countries such as China, Japan, South Korea, and Taiwan. North America follows, supported by advanced aerospace, defense, and electronics industries, along with significant R&D investments.

Europe shows steady growth due to strong demand from automotive engineering, renewable energy, and advanced manufacturing sectors. Latin America and the Middle East & Africa are emerging markets, supported by growing industrial investments and gradual adoption of advanced materials in energy and chemical processing industries.
